Reacquaint yourself with the Civil Rights Movement....

This is a well written book which is a great read for someone who already has knowledge about the Civil Rights Movement. I selected this book in search of a text, perhaps supplementary, for a class that I teach. I realized a few pages into it that it would not be appropriate for a class or person without prior knowledge of the Movement. I did find that it reminded me of topics that are important to cover with my class. John Salmond has done a great job of hitting the "high points". At 163 pages, it was the perfect refresher course for this teacher! I recommend this book to anyone who has thought about, or lived during the Movement, and wants to be reminded of its impact and relavance. My Mind Set on Freedom is a great addition to libraries that pertain to U.S. History. It is a moving account: a real page turner.
